📅  最后修改于: 2020-10-16 07:54:51             🧑  作者: Mango
当今的职业生活充满活力,要与之相伴,我们需要适当的职业规划。当您开始以软件开发人员的职业生涯时,您确实不知道自己在行业中的表现如何,尽管您确信所做的任何事情都会以最佳的方式完成。因此,请花一些时间调查一下自己,您的主要优点和缺点是什么,并且基于至少3-4年的经验,您可以提出不同的选择:
您是否想永远继续作为软件开发人员,这可能是一个很好的选择,并且有很多人永远喜欢编码。
如果您在设计软件组件方面非常擅长并且您过去的设计得到了广泛的赞赏,那么您可以考虑进入技术方面并成为软件架构师。
如果您善于管理事务,对人有很好的指挥能力并具有令人信服的能力,那么您可以考虑担任管理角色,这将从领导一个小型团队开始。
如果您在事物管理方面非常擅长,同时又具有良好的架构意识,那么您可以考虑成为技术经理,在那里您将继续为组件设计做出贡献,并管理团队和项目。
无论是什么,您都必须知道要到达的地方。一旦确定了这一点,就应该从您的项目偏好直到培训和认证开始朝着相同的方向工作。您当前的组织可能没有给您适当的机会到达您想要的目的地,然后您可以等待适当的时间并转到其他好的组织,但是这种情况应该不会很频繁。我见过有人只是因为很少远足而每六个月就从一个组织跳到另一个组织,而这样做的过程没有适当的思考和适当的计划,但是这些人不知道他们长期会失去什么。
您可以与经理/直属经理讨论您的职业道路,并且大多数组织都为员工定义了标准的职业道路,因此您可以检查它是否适合您的兴趣并相应地工作。
这是一个非常有趣的问题,当我应该搬到另一个组织时,却无法用简单的语言回答。您知道您的职业道路,如果您目前的组织足以将您带到最终目的地,那么您为什么要离开它。仅仅因为花很少的钱就离开一个组织永远不是一个好理由,即使您获得良好的职位和大幅加薪,即使太频繁地离开组织也不是一个好主意,这仅仅是因为您失去了信誉,没有一家好的公司会依靠您,因为您始终身陷金钱和职位,因此谁知道您何时离开他们。
如果您的组织内部存在一些内部人力资源或管理问题,请尝试解决这些问题,因为您永远都不知道您的下一个组织可能会遇到比当前组织更大的问题。您可以与经理,主管或人力资源部门讨论您的问题,并妥善解决。
如果您在当前的组织中看不到进一步的增长和良好的职业选择,并且同时您的学习曲线已趋于饱和,那么该是时候转向另一个组织了。在某些情况下,您的薪水虽然不高,但在您当前的组织中没有担任重要职务,但您正在学习很多东西,这将为您的履历和职业增添很多价值,然后最好还是坚持目前的组织直到学习结束。